Ángel T. Martı́nez is a scholar working on Plant Science, Biotechnology and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Ángel T. Martı́nez has authored 330 papers receiving a total of 19.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 249 papers in Plant Science, 156 papers in Biotechnology and 128 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Ángel T. Martı́nez’s work include Enzyme-mediated dye degradation (234 papers), Biochemical and biochemical processes (117 papers) and Lignin and Wood Chemistry (100 papers). Ángel T. Martı́nez is often cited by papers focused on Enzyme-mediated dye degradation (234 papers), Biochemical and biochemical processes (117 papers) and Lignin and Wood Chemistry (100 papers). Ángel T. Martı́nez collaborates with scholars based in Spain, United States and Germany. Ángel T. Martı́nez's co-authors include Marı́a Jesús Martı́nez, Ana Gutiérrez, José C. del Rı́o, Francisco J. Ruiz‐Dueñas, Susana Camarero, Jorge Rencoret, Francisco Guillén, David Ibarra, Patrícia Ferreira and Jesús Jiménez‐Barbero and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Angewandte Chemie International Edition and Journal of Biological Chemistry.
